Buffalo milk, from which conventional mozzarella cheese is made, has a characteristic blend of modified fatty acids reminiscent of mushrooms and freshly minimize grass, together with a barnyardy nitrogen compound . In arid southwest Asia, goat and sheep milk was flippantly fermented into yogurt that could presumably be saved for several days, sun-dried, or saved under oil; or curdled into cheese that could be eaten contemporary or preserved by drying or brining. This is an exceptionally long-lived blog, a real Methuselah of the food blogs. The creation of skilled cook dinner, baker, cookbook author,David Lebovitz was launched in 1999, when a lot of the now bloggers, if already born, surely hadn’t heard about food running a blog. The weblog was intended as an offshoot meant to help the launch of David’s first cookbookRoom for Dessert. In 2019,Saveurmagazine honored it with their first-ever ‘Blog of the Decade’ award.

Michael Chu is a California-based engineer with an analytical mind, a well-equipped kitchen, a love of food, and an excellent web site. Unwilling to accept the frequent wisdom, he exams all kitchen assumptions as he wrestles recipes to the bottom one at a time. There is a small but rising message board that accompanies it.
